Airports in Shanghai
Shanghai Pudong International Airport (PVG)
Shanghai Pudong International Airport (PVG) is around 35 miles from central Shanghai. If you're grabbing a cab or a ride-share, the drive takes roughly 50 minutes.

Shanghai Hongqiao International Airport (SHA)
After your flight from Daegu International Airport to Shanghai has arrived, you can reach the city center in around 20 minutes by car. Central Shanghai is roughly 9 miles from Shanghai Hongqiao International Airport (SHA).

Best time to go to Shanghai
Before booking your flights from Daegu International Airport to Shanghai, consider which time of year is best for you. High season in Shanghai offers a bustling atmosphere and plenty of activities, while low season means you'll get cheaper hotel deals and smaller crowds.
Lock in a Daegu International Airport to Shanghai plane ticket with a departure in August if you're eager to visit the city during its warmest month. Expect temperatures to range from 73ºF to 93ºF.
Search for cheap tickets from TAE to Shanghai in January if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 30ºF and 50ºF on average.
